Scope: emergency write access to the Stallport parking-garage occupancy pipeline when both on-call operators are unreachable. Trigger criteria: feed stale >15 minutes across all Kettering Plaza levels, or corrupt counts propagating to signage. Procedure: open the sealed access record, log the timestamp, notify the duty auditor within one hour. All actions are session-recorded. Access expires after 30 minutes. The sealed record contains the unlock passphrase, reproduced below for reviewer verification.

unlock words, hahip-yagef: zorok-novmir-zorix-silax

The Wavecrest preview endpoint generates a downsampled waveform image for any uploaded audio asset. Plugin authors should request peaks at no more than 2000 samples per minute of audio; higher densities are rejected. Responses are cached for one hour per asset revision. All requests must authenticate against the internal Soundloft rendering service, whose key is shown below.

app token of kawif-yafop = zpat2_88

## Releases (Wavecrumb)

Tag from main only. CI builds the waveform-preview renderer, runs the golden-image audio tests, and produces signed artifacts. Release manager checklist: confirm peak-normalization snapshots match, bump the version in render.toml, and cut the tag. Previews regenerate lazily after deploy, so expect blank waveforms for up to ten minutes. Do not force-regenerate during peak hours. Every release artifact must verify against the signing key below.

release key, fahaf-bajof: bky3_Xam

Finance Review Summary — Loyalty Overhaul

Heads of department: the Brightmile points scheme redesign is fully costed. Liability on unredeemed points drops an estimated 18% under the new expiry rules; migration costs land in Q2. Marketing spend is flat. Approval is expected at the next steering session. The confidential note below sets out the commercial plan.

internal memo for yahag-tahog: The pricing group signed off on a budget of $152.8 million for Project Soriel.

**Bikes and parking.** Contractors are welcome to use the bike cage by the north gate — just don't leave anything overnight, as it's cleared weekly. If you're driving, the parking gates at Wrenfield Yard open from 07:00 and you'll need to buzz the desk on your first visit. After that, the gates and cage both take the contractor code below.

door code, yagap-bahof: bdg-O-05